Electron and Ion Beam Characterization
Electron and ion beams are widely used for both qualitative and quantitative analysis of semiconductor materials and devices. They can be used to image structures with sub-nm resolution and to provide information about elemental composition and dopant concentration. This course describes the fundamentals of electron and ion beam characterization and includes a project that analyzes the surface roughness of a solar cell.

THINK GLOBAL: TEACHERS TRAINING COURSE (IDP-ICE)
A group of seven European partners from Catalonia, Belgium, and Wales worked together on the Erasmus+ funded ‘Think Global’ project on global competence. The project seeks to address the following research question through development and piloting of practical classroom activities: What is global competence, and how can it be learned effectively? The Think Global project explores, through international collaboration, how global competence is defined, taught, learned, and measured in the classroom. It offers a model of professional learning for teachers to support students in developing global competence and its relationship with ODS. So, this training course is addressed to school teachers and other school stakeholders. The focus of the course is to empower school teachers to implement cross-curricular projects on global competence, and it is delivered in an open online platform. The course is divided into five modules. The first is an overview of cross-cultural theory on global competences, the theoretical framework and the research and studies developed on the topic. The second module is based on principles and strategies. The third module deals with methodologies and developing global competence programs. The fourth module is about project based learning. The last module of the course consists of designing a global competence project to be implemented in the classroom. Teachers can decide what they need to work to achieve their objectives. In this way, they can decide which modules they need to work on, however it can be interesting to develop a final project to develop all the modules. It can provide teachers with a deeper understanding and reflections about our subjects and the development of global competence.

Crunch Vectors with GeoPandas
Working with spatial data means more than making maps—it means producing results that planners and decision-makers can trust. In this short, hands-on course, Crunch Vectors with GeoPandas, learners practice transforming raw vector data into map-ready, planning-quality insights using GeoPandas. Through realistic examples and guided activities, learners perform spatial joins between cities and counties, choose spatial relationships intentionally, reproject data to EPSG:3857 for web mapping, and summarize attributes into clear service-territory totals. Designed for beginner data analysts, this course builds confidence in spatial reasoning, validation, and aggregation—helping learners deliver datasets that support accurate mapping, reporting, and real-world planning decisions.

Using Sensors With Your Raspberry Pi
This course on integrating sensors with your Raspberry Pi is course 3 of a Coursera Specialization and can be taken separately or as part of the specialization. Although some material and explanations from the prior two courses are used, this course largely assumes no prior experience with sensors or data processing other than ideas about your own projects and an interest in building projects with sensors. This course focuses on core concepts and techniques in designing and integrating any sensor, rather than overly specific examples to copy. This method allows you to use these concepts in your projects to build highly customized sensors for your applications. Some of the ideas covered include calibrating sensors and the trade-offs between different mathematical methods of storing and applying calibration curves to your sensors. We also discuss accuracy, precision, and how to understand uncertainty in your measurements. We study methods of interfacing analog sensors with your Raspberry Pi (or other platform) with amplifiers and the theory and technique involved in reducing noise with spectral filters. Lastly, we borrow from the fields of data science, statistics, and digital signal processing, to post-process our data in Python.
